Bereavement

Loss, due to death, of someone to whom one feels close and the process of adjustment to the loss.

Emotional Loss

A profound sense of sadness or grief that occurs as a response to the absence or departure of a loved one, or the loss of an abstract element that had significant value.

The emotional response that Anna is experiencing in the scenario is grief. Grief is the natural response to loss, and it can manifest in a variety of ways, including sadness, anger, despair, and physical symptoms. Anna's inability to eat, work, or care for her other children is a common expression of grief. Denial refers to a refusal to acknowledge or accept the reality of a situation, while bereavement is the period of mourning after a loss. Resolution refers to the eventual acceptance and adjustment to the loss. While Anna may eventually reach a stage of resolution, her current emotional state is more consistent with early grief.
